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6756 798791 12878866 569367068 77678
1061651172 82110871 63237952
1061651172 82110871 63237952
85 370792329 331 52146851363 70077667247
All about undefined
Interested in learning more?
1061651172 82110871 63237952
85 370792329 331 52146851363 70077667247
See more
03744 520247205 80639874
124686401 58894553 086283 30
See more
3670239234 28118500702
537 03 57
See more